Hello, I just set up my Sierra chart Web based trade panel. Is there a way I can see the whole bracket order(target, stop) in open orders ? Or do they only show up once in current positions? Thanks
[2020-05-11 11:31:56]
Sierra Chart Engineering - Posts: 104368
We need to prepare documentation for this. The web-based trading panel has a Server Selector section at the top for you to select a particular server to connect to.

You need to be connecting to the same server that Global Settings >> Data/Trade Service Settings >> Service Setting >> Primary Server is set to in Sierra Chart.

Otherwise, if the parent order has not yet filled and you are connected to a different server you will not see the Target and Stop. In any case, they will only be listed in the Open Orders table.
